一、技术更名背后的战略升级:从工具到生态的跃迁
MoltBot的更名并非简单的品牌重塑,而是技术栈全面升级的信号。对比其前身Clawdbot,新版本在三个层面实现质的飞跃:
- 架构解耦:采用微服务化设计,将模型训练、推理优化、资源调度等模块拆分为独立服务,支持按需组合部署。例如,开发者可通过配置文件灵活切换不同规模的推理引擎,无需重构代码即可适配边缘设备或云端集群。
- 异构计算支持:新增对GPU、NPU、ASIC等多元算力的动态调度能力。通过内置的算力感知层,MoltBot可自动识别硬件特性并优化计算图执行路径。测试数据显示,在混合部署场景下,资源利用率提升达65%。
- 生态兼容性:构建标准化接口层,支持与主流机器学习框架(如TensorFlow、PyTorch)无缝对接。开发者无需修改现有模型代码,仅需通过适配器转换即可完成迁移,迁移成本降低80%以上。
二、核心能力拆解:三大技术突破重塑开发体验
1. 动态模型优化引擎
MoltBot的模型优化模块采用两阶段优化策略:
- 编译时优化:通过图级融合、常量折叠等技术,将模型转换为中间表示(IR),消除冗余计算节点。例如,在BERT模型优化中,可减少30%的矩阵乘法操作。
- 运行时优化:基于硬件反馈的动态调整机制,实时监控内存带宽、缓存命中率等指标,动态调整计算粒度。在某图像分类任务中,该机制使推理延迟波动范围从±15ms压缩至±3ms。
# 示例:MoltBot的动态批处理配置optimizer = MoltOptimizer(batch_size_range=(8, 128),latency_threshold=50, # 单位:msauto_tune=True)optimized_model = optimizer.fit(original_model)
2. 分布式训练加速框架
针对大规模模型训练场景,MoltBot提供三重加速方案:
- 通信优化:采用分层混合并行策略,结合数据并行与模型并行,减少梯度同步开销。在千亿参数模型训练中,通信时间占比从45%降至18%。
- 容错恢复:内置检查点机制支持秒级故障恢复,结合增量同步技术避免全量重训。某实验显示,在100节点集群中,训练任务因节点故障中断后的恢复时间从2小时缩短至8分钟。
- 弹性伸缩:支持动态添加/移除训练节点,资源调整过程中保持训练连续性。通过Kubernetes集成,可实现跨可用区资源调度,满足企业级高可用需求。
3. 自动化调参工具链
MoltBot的AutoML模块集成三大创新技术:
- 多目标优化算法:同时优化模型精度、推理速度、内存占用等指标,通过帕累托前沿分析找到最优解集。
- 迁移学习支持:构建预训练模型知识库,支持基于任务相似度的参数初始化。在NLP任务中,该技术使调参时间从72小时压缩至12小时。
- 可视化分析平台:提供交互式调参过程回放功能,开发者可直观对比不同参数组合的效果差异。某团队反馈,该功能使其模型迭代效率提升3倍。
三、应用场景实践:从实验室到产业落地的全链路支持
1. 智能客服系统开发
某企业基于MoltBot构建智能客服系统,实现三大突破:
- 低延迟响应:通过模型量化技术将BERT模型压缩至原大小的1/10,结合硬件加速使90%请求延迟控制在200ms以内。
- 多轮对话管理:利用MoltBot的状态跟踪模块,实现上下文感知的对话策略,客户问题解决率提升25%。
- 持续学习机制:通过在线学习接口实时更新模型,无需停止服务即可吸收新数据,模型准确率周环比提升1.2%。
2. 工业质检场景落地
在某电子制造企业的产线质检中,MoltBot展现显著优势:
- 小样本学习能力:采用元学习技术,仅需50张缺陷样本即可训练可用模型,数据采集成本降低90%。
- 边缘部署方案:通过模型剪枝与量化,将YOLOv5模型压缩至3MB,可在嵌入式设备实现15FPS的实时检测。
- 异常检测扩展:集成无监督学习模块,支持对未知缺陷类型的自动识别,漏检率降低至0.3%以下。
3. 科研领域创新应用
某高校团队利用MoltBot加速分子模拟研究:
- 混合精度训练:结合FP16与FP32计算,在保持精度前提下将训练速度提升2.8倍。
- 分布式推理优化:通过算子融合技术减少GPU内存访问次数,使单次模拟耗时从12小时缩短至3.5小时。
- 可解释性工具包:提供SHAP值计算、注意力可视化等功能,帮助研究人员理解模型决策过程。
四、技术生态展望:构建开放共赢的AI开发新范式
MoltBot团队正推进三大生态建设举措:
- 开发者社区计划:推出模型贡献奖励机制,优秀开源模型可获得云资源支持与技术认证。
- 企业级支持方案:提供私有化部署工具包与SLA保障服务,满足金融、医疗等行业的合规需求。
- 硬件协同创新:与芯片厂商共建联合实验室,针对新型AI芯片开发定制化优化方案。
在AI技术加速迭代的当下,MoltBot通过架构革新、能力突破与生态构建,为开发者提供了一站式解决方案。其技术理念与实现路径,不仅为同类工具提供了重要参考,更预示着AI开发范式正从”工具驱动”向”生态驱动”演进。对于希望提升开发效率、降低技术门槛的团队而言,MoltBot的实践值得深入研究与借鉴。